Asian Masters Athletic Championship – 2017: Kodagu’s Machamma Ponnappa wins gold in Shot Put
October 4, 2017Maramada Machamma Ponnappa, a resident of Hudikeri in South Kodagu, won the gold medal in the recently concluded Asian Masters Athletic Championships at Rugao, China. Monthly meeting of Railway Pensioners
October 4, 2017The monthly meeting of the Railway Pensioners Welfare Association, Mysuru, will be held at A. Manual Hall on Seshadri Iyer Road in city on Oct. 8 at 10.30 am. Association President G. Armugam will preside. For details, contact Mob: 98457-90343.
